Pickled Eggplants That Taste Like Mushrooms for Winter
A savory homemade preserve of eggplant with garlic, pepper, and fresh herbs that tastes remarkably like pickled mushrooms. A fantastic appetizer for the winter table.

Method
Trim the stems off the eggplants and cut them into large batons.
Bring a pot of water to a boil, add the eggplants, and boil for 5 minutes. Then, remove the eggplants from the pot using a slotted spoon.
Finely chop the dill, parsley, and peeled garlic cloves.
Core the red bell pepper and dice it finely.
In a mixing bowl, combine the pepper, herbs, and garlic, season with salt, and add coriander and ground black pepper to taste.
Pour the vinegar and vegetable oil into the pepper and herb mixture, then stir well.
Add the eggplants to the pepper and herb mixture and mix again.
Pack the eggplants with the herbs and garlic tightly into clean, dry jars. Pour any remaining marinade evenly over the jars and cover with lids.
Line a pot with a towel and place the jars on the bottom. Fill the pot with water up to the shoulders of the jars and bring to a boil over the heat.
Once boiling, process the jars for 10 minutes.
Remove the jars from the pot, seal them tightly, and turn them upside down. It is recommended to wrap the jars in a blanket and leave them until they cool completely.
